Link Checker
The Link Checker tool helps you check your links to ensure that they
link to the page that you expect them to, and that they tag your link
with your Associate ID or one of your Tracking IDs. Your links must
correctly tag to your Associate ID or one of your Tracking IDs in order
for you to earn referrals.
Note: You need to be signed in to Associate Central to use this
tool. For privacy purposes, the tool will only test the tagging of
links against the Associate ID or Tracking IDs of the currently logged
in account.
The Link Checker checks the tagging for a URL linking to Amazon.co.uk.
This tool is intended primarily for people constructing or modifying
their own Associate links to Amazon.co.uk. Using the Build Links/Widgets
tools when signed in to Associate Central should produce correctly
tagging links and widgets.
The Link Checker does NOT check the tagging for our served links such
as Omakase or Recommended Product Links. It also does NOT check the
tagging for Widgets. For served links and widgets, our Associate
Central Build Links/Widgets tools will automatically include the
Associate ID or Tracking ID that you have selected when you are logged
in to Associate Central while building the link or widget.
However for accurate tracking, reporting and fee accrual, you
must ensure that the links between your site and the Amazon.co.uk site
are properly formatted.
The process for checking your link URLs is a two step process:
1. Enter your link URL into the field and click the 'Load Link' button.
2. After you see the correct page load in the
frame, click the 'Check Link' button below the loaded page to check
that the link is tagged to your Associates ID or one of your Tracking
IDs.
What do the Link Checker responses mean?
The Link Checker is designed to confirm whether a link tags to your Associate ID or one of your Tracking IDs.
After you have loaded the URL and clicked the Check Link button, you will get one of the following responses:
- Success: The link tags to a valid tag or sub-tag for your Associate ID.
This means your link is tagging correctly to your account.
- Fail: The link does not correctly tag for your Account.
This
means the tag in the URL is not the Associate ID or Tracking ID for the
currently logged in account. You will need to check the tag in the URL.
To see your list of Tracking IDs or to create new ones, click the manage link beside Tracking ID in the blue sign-in and status box in the top left corner of the page.
